You can indeed do any team comp you want so don't take me wrong but since u explained your reasoning it just feels weird you'd just stack necros. They are not really that good and cannot provide the buffs you need.

For healing ele/druid are both better and i'd prefer druid for party buffs. Druid can also tank easily and replace engi.

You need to consider the buff upkeep as well and throw a chrono in. A chrono doesn't take much away from party and gives quickness to everybody + shares other buffs on top. Can also be used as a tank if needed.

With the necro trait i dont think fury is needed that much tbh so i'll skip that.

For defense purposes get a rev to give protection and also help chrono with quickness if not tanking (comm gear)

So end result would be: Druid / Chrono / Rev / 2 Warrs and 5 necro. In this scenario druid will be using sun spirit i guess.
